      ABSTRACT = {We describe a novel method for coping with ungrammatical input based on the use of chart-like data structures, which permit anytime processing. Priority is given to deep syntactic analysis. Should this fail, the best partial analyses are selected, according to a shortest-paths algorithm, and assembled in a robust processing phase. The method has been applied in a speech translation project with large HPSG grammars.},

      ABSTRACT = {This paper describes a tool for supporting grammar development in those linguistic frameworks which employ some constraint-based formalism, such as LFG (Lexical Functional Grammar), HPSG (Head-Driven Phrase Structure Grammar), FUG (Functional Unification Grammar) and CUG (Categorial Unification Grammar). These approaches have in common that all or at least a substantial part of the grammar (such as rules, lexical entries, node labels etc.) is represented as sets of attribute-value pairs. In LISP or Prolog the structures can be internally represented as lists, but it is much more convenient and sometimes even indispensable to use graphical representations when developing grammars. During grammar processing, feature structures can become quite large (up to several thousand nodes), such that a customized view of the feature structure, which allows to selectively focus on relevant parts, becomes essential. Fegramed provides a fully interactive editor for developing, maintaining and viewing feature structures. It is a tool that is built to cope with the complexity of feature structures in grammar development and use.},

      ABSTRACT = {We present a context-free approximation of unification-based grammars, such as HPSG or PATR-II. The theoretical underpinning is established through a least fixpoint construction over a certain monotonic function. In order to reach a finite fixpoint, the concrete implementation can be parameterized in several ways, either by specifying a finite iteration depth, by using different restrictors, or by making the symbols of the CFG more complex adding annotations à la GPSG. We also present several methods that speed up the approximation process and help to limit the size of the resulting CF grammar.}

      ABSTRACT = {We present a novel disambiguation method for unificationbased grammars (UBGs). In contrast to other methods, our approach obviates the need for probability models on the UBG side in that it shifts the responsibility to simpler contextfree models, indirectly obtained from the UBG. Our approach has three advantages: (i) training can be effectively done in practice, (ii) parsing and disambiguation of contextfree readings requires only cubic time, and (iii) involved probability distributions are mathematically clean. In an experiment for a midsize UBG, we show that our novel approach is feasible. Using unsupervised training, we achieve 88% accuracy on an exactmatch task.},

      ABSTRACT = {We present a compilation algorithm that translates Head Driven Phrase Structure Grammars into lexicalized feature based Tree Adjoining Grammars. Through this exercise we attempt to gain further insights into the nature of the two theories and to identify correlating concepts. While HPSG has a more elaborated lexicalized and principle-based theory of functor argument structures, TAG provides the means to represent lexical-based structural information more explicitly and to factor out recursion. Our objectives are met by giving clear and simple definitions for projecting structure from the lexicon, for determining maximal projections, and for identifying potential auxiliary trees and foot nodes.}
